            Really Advanced - Array Sizes and Passing Arrays to

                   Subroutines and Functions:


                   Sometimes we need to create programming code that would work with an
                   array of any size. If you specify a question mark as a index, row, or column
                   number in the square bracket reference of an array BASIC-256 will return the
                   dimensioned size. In Program 92 we modified Program 91 to display the
                   array regardless of it's length. You will see the special [?] used on line 16 to
                   return the current size of the array.
